This is an A.R. & J.E. Meylan Type 204A mechanical stopwatch. Typically features a nickel or silver-toned case with a mineral glass face Key Identification Features Manufacturer: Marked as "A.R. & J.E. MEYLAN" on the dial face, a specialized Swiss firm that established the Meylan Stopwatch Corporation in New York in 1921. Model Type: The Type 204A is specifically characterized by this dual-scale layout: a 60-second outer track and a small 30-minute recording sub-dial at the top. Visual Indicators: It features the characteristic red "60" at the top of the main dial and high-quality Swiss-made internal components, often utilizing a 7-jewel mechanical movement. Usage & Heritage These stopwatches were standard precision instruments for industrial, scientific, and sporting applications during the mid-20th century. While often used for general timekeeping, similar models from this era were frequently utilized for high-stakes professional tasks, including as military bomb timers or for railway time studies.
